Library_CLI

  1. git clone https://github.com/Hassan-Elseoudy/Library_CL
  2. Run it using your java compiler or your preferred IDE!

Note: If I had all the time In the life, I'd added

  1. Using Commander design patter, encapsulatin each command with each validation.
  2. Handle more validation cases, The project based on an INTELLIGENT user, but it shouldn't be the case.
  3. Dockerizing the application, so you don't depend on the OS.
  4. Adding MySQL connection, but yet, I'm not pretty sure about the tester environment.
  5. Adding tests, full documentation, but :))